㈣憑想象寫出來的短語
例一:Intensive pioneering efforts
這是某網(wǎng)站介紹公司歷史的一個標題,按英語的意思想不出對應(yīng)的中文持寄。按理說穿肄,即使是people mountain people sea年局,也能猜出是“人山人海”啊咸产。將Intensive pioneering efforts輸入搜索引擎矢否,必應(yīng)出來一個例句:
Eight years' intensive and pioneering effort brings GYU an abundant harvest.(八年艱苦創(chuàng)業(yè)不輟耕耘,幾年的奮斗拼搏碩果累累脑溢。)
請注意,搜索結(jié)果是intensive and pioneering effort屑彻,多了個and验庙,并且effort后面沒有s。
百度出來好多個含有intensive?and?pioneering?effort的網(wǎng)頁社牲,全是中國網(wǎng)站粪薛,看來這是還沒被主流英語接受的中式英語。借助中英文對照搏恤,原來intensive and pioneering efforts的中文是艱苦創(chuàng)業(yè)的意思违寿。對了,將Intensive pioneering efforts輸入百度機器翻譯的結(jié)果是“密集的努力開拓”熟空,谷歌的機器翻譯結(jié)果是“強化開拓力度”藤巢,必應(yīng)機器翻譯的結(jié)果是“強化開拓性的努力”,機器翻譯那家強息罗?
其實掂咒,一說早年的艱苦歲月,學過《新概念英語》的迈喉,應(yīng)該還記得第二冊有一課叫success story绍刮,課文中有一句:
Frank smiled when he remembered his hard early years and the long road to success.(當弗蘭克回想起他早年的艱難經(jīng)歷和走過的漫長的成功之路,他笑了挨摸。)[30]這不就是簡單而又地道的英文嗎录淡?
例二:該項目由各參與方合資經(jīng)營,是澳大利亞最大的天然資源項目油坝。
This project, the largest natural resources project in Australia,would be?under a joint run?by all participants.
這純屬沒事找事嫉戚,好端端的動詞形式不用,生生造了一個介詞短語under a joint run澈圈。run成了名詞彬檀,沒有了經(jīng)營的含義,后面的by瞬女,本來是引出被動語態(tài)動作的施加者窍帝,也就不對了。Would be run jointly by all participants不是挺好嗎诽偷?

㈤縮略詞
所謂縮略詞acronym,《柯林斯英漢雙解大詞典》給出的定義:An?acronym?is a word composed of the first letters of the words in a phrase, especially when this is used as a name. An example of an acronym is NATO which is made up of the first letters of the "North Atlantic Treaty Organization."
還有個縮略詞的單詞叫initialism菇用,但是權(quán)威詞典暫時未收錄澜驮,必應(yīng)詞典給出的定義是:an abbreviation made up of initial letters that are all pronounced separately, e.g. UN for United Nations.
也就是說,首字母連起來能作為單詞發(fā)音的叫acronym惋鸥,如NATO杂穷、OPEC等悍缠,只能挨個讀字母的叫initialism九串,如FBI秸仙、CIA等。

如何使用縮略詞,也是有一些基本要求的聘芜。在網(wǎng)上找到不少關(guān)于如何使用縮略詞的文章兄渺,下面摘錄的是John A.Duttone-Education Institute網(wǎng)站關(guān)于縮略詞的使用要求:
·Always write out the first in-text reference to an acronym, followed by the acronym itself written in capital letters and enclosed by parentheses. Subsequentreferences to the acronym can bemade just by the capital letters alone. For example:
Geographic Information Systems (GIS) is a rapidly expanding field. GIS technology . . .
·Unless they appear at the end of a sentence, do not follow acronyms with a period.
·Generally, acronyms can be pluralized with the addition of a lowercase “s” (“three URLs”); acronyms can be made possessive with an a postrophe followed by a lowercase “s” (“the DOD’s mandate”).
·As subjects, acronyms should be treated as singulars, even when they stand for plurals; therefore, they require a singular verb (“NIOSH is committed to . . .”).
·Be sure to learn and correctly use acronyms associated with professional organizations or certifications within your field (e.g., ASME for American Society of Mechanical Engineers; PE for Professional Engineer).
·With few exceptions, present acronyms in full capital letters (FORTRAN; NIOSH). Some acronyms, such as “scuba” and“radar,” are so commonly used that they are not capitalized. Consult the table that follows in the next section to help determine which commonly used acronyms do not appear in all capital letters.
·When an acronym must be preceded by “a” or“an” in a sentence, discern which word to use based on sound rather than the acronym’s meaning. If a soft vowel sound opens the acronym,use “an,” even if the acronym stands for words that open with a hard sound (i.e., “a special boatunit,” but “an SBU”). If the acronym opens with a hard sound, use “a” (“a KC-135tanker”)[31].
